Analysis
Mexico recorded 466,821 for secondary education, teachers, female, gaps filled in 2023. That is the highest value across all 26 years on record.
Compared with earlier readings it is up 3.3% on the previous year and up 38.5% over ten years.
Over the whole period, secondary education, teachers, female, gaps filled in Mexico peaked at 466,821 in 2023 and was at its lowest, 55,218, in 1976.
That places Mexico 8th out of 198 countries with data for 2023, putting it in the top 10%.
The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 26 years of available data.

How this figure is calculated
Secondary education, teachers, female with 670 missing years estimated by linear interpolation between the nearest real observations. Only gaps of 4 years or fewer are filled, and never beyond the first or last actual measurement — these are filled holes, not forecasts.
Computed from
- Secondary education, teachers, female Data API, UN Educational, Scientific and Cultural Organization (UNESCO)
Statizoid computes this series; the underlying measurements belong to the publishers named above. The arithmetic is applied to every country and year where both inputs report, and nothing is estimated unless the page says so.
